- The distance between West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ands, Australia and Moscow, Russia is approximately 9,329 km or 5,797 mi.
- To reach West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ands in this distance one would set out from Moscow bearing 122.4°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ach West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ands bearing 151° or SSE .
- West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Moscow has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- The mean annual temperature is 21.7 °C (39°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.9 °C (46.6°F) less in West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1249.3 mm (49.2 in) more which is equivalent to 1249.3 l/m² (30.66 US gal/ft²) or 12,493,000 l/ha (1,335,585 US gal/ac) more. About 2 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 37.9° higher in West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ands than in Moscow.
